Datascore says farewell to Summer Tour and Lisa DeGuire

Datascore wrapped up their Summer Tour last month at the Liquid Lime in Kirkland . It was a dark, rain-soaked day, better spent indoors playing the game we love so much. Throw in some cash, trophies and bragging rights and you've got a recipe for high-energy excitement.

Sixty four out of the original 130 Datascore Tour players qualified for the finals based on their point accumulation since July - 54 of them were in attendance on Saturday, November 4. Tour participants were awarded points for showing up, for placing and for their accomplishments at the boards. The top male and female point earners were Rob Morrison and Kim Pearson, who will be furnished with a trophy honoring their dedication.

The finals event was a $700 guaranteed added, free entry, parity draw. Dave Foster and his partner, Holly Rasley, sat comfortably in the driver's seat while waiting for James Johnson, Jr. and Kim Pearson to finish playing Dominic Gavino and Lisa DeGuire, determining their next opponents. After an impressive battle and some amazing DeGuire darts, Lisa and Dominic advanced into the final match.

Dave Foster was his usual amazing self in the final match, with plenty of clutch darts from Holly. But Lisa and Dominic played them extremely tough, taking them to the final game and losing by one dart. Awesome finale to another great show of support from those faithful Datascore players.

Now, it didn't seem a coincidence that Lisa was on fire throughout the finals. This tournament gathering also marked her departure from the Datascore group after five incredible years of service. Lisa is one of the most appreciated and visible dart players on the Eastside and her regular involvement will be missed. However, she has no intention of disappearing altogether, by any means. Lisa will stay in the area and maintain all her friendships through a continued career in darts. Datascore will miss having the benefit of Lisa's help and daily influence, but wish her well in her new job.

Todd Hamilton, of Datascore, said that maybe he would leave the company too so he could finally win in the tour finals, insinuating Lisa's ultimate success directly corresponded to her decision to move on.
